Oxygen Renews Tentpole Series "Snapped" for Two New Seasons
The series will return for seasons 37 and 38, along with the expansion of the franchise with "Snapped: Killer Moms" (wt).

OXYGEN RENEWS TENTPOLE SERIES "SNAPPED" FOR TWO NEW SEASONS

EXPANDS FRANCHISE WITH "SNAPPED: KILLER MOMS" AND GREENLIGHTS TRUE-CRIME DOCUMENTARY "HOOTERS MURDERS: DEADLY SHIFT"

December 4, 2025 - Oxygen, the home of high-quality, true-crime programming, announced today a slate of new pickups expanding its powerhouse lineup, including the renewal of the network's signature series Snapped for seasons 37 and 38, along with the expansion of the Snapped franchise with Snapped: Killer Moms (working title). The network has also greenlit the original documentary Hooters Murders: Deadly Shift (working title). These announcements underscore Oxygen's continued growth as a top destination for smart, compelling true-crime storytelling under the VERSANT Entertainment portfolio.

Across its most recent seasons, Snapped remains Oxygen's top-performing series and a leader in the true-crime genre. The long-running franchise continues to deliver strong multi-platform viewership, ranking as the #1 most viewed original cable entertainment series in its timeslot in 2025. Season 36 of Snapped will debut on Oxygen on Sunday, January 4 at 6pm ET/PT, ahead of celebrating its 700th episode next year.

"Snapped has long been a cornerstone of Oxygen, and we're thrilled to continue the franchise with two more seasons while expanding its universe with Snapped: Killer Moms. Alongside the gripping new documentary Hooters Murders: Deadly Shift, these additions underscore our commitment to delivering riveting true-crime stories that keep audiences engaged and coming back for more," said Cori Abraham, Senior Vice President, Unscripted Content, VERSANT.

One of television's longest running and successful true-crime franchises, Snapped has profiled the fascinating cases of women accused of heinous acts for 35 seasons. Whether the motivation was revenge against a cheating husband, the promise of a hefty insurance payoff, or putting an end to years of abuse, the reasons are as varied as the women themselves. From socialites to secretaries, these female criminals share one thing in common: at some point, they all snapped. The series will celebrate its 700th episode next year. Snapped is produced by Jupiter Entertainment. Patrick Reardon, David O'Donnell and Deborah Allen serve as executive producers, along with showrunner Madeline Griffey.

Mothers will do absolutely anything for their children. Snapped: Killer Moms (w/t) is a true crime series that highlights high-emotion and high-stakes stories where a mother's unconditional love twists into bloodshed, as matriarchs stop at nothing to protect or avenge their kids. Each episode peels back the layers of seemingly ordinary women whose motherly instincts lead them to unthinkable violence. Snapped: Killer Moms (w/t) is produced by Jupiter Entertainment. Patrick Reardon will serve as executive producer.

From 2001 to 2010, three women - a newlywed, a college hopeful, and a young mom - were murdered in cold blood. Separated by thousands of miles, they shared one connection: they were all "Hooters Girls." Hooters Murders: Deadly Shift (w/t) is a two-hour documentary that unravels the tragic murders of three "Hooters Girls," exposing how young women who worked at the iconic "family-restaurant" chain were preyed upon. Hooters Murders: Deadly Shift (w/t) is co-produced by Expectation and The Intellectual Property Corporation (a part of Sony Pictures Television). Kevin Brennecke will serve as showrunner with Ben Wicks and Tim Hincks of Expectation and Eli Holzman and Aaron Saidman of The Intellectual Property Corporation (IPC) executive producing. The documentary was developed by Amy Dallmeyer.
